What is a Cashback Offer?
A cashback offer is a type of promotion where a casino refunds a percentage of your losses over a certain period. This can range anywhere from 5% to 25% of your net losses, giving you a second chance to recoup your funds.
How Does Cashback Work?
Cashback offers typically apply to your net losses, which means the total amount wagered minus the total amount won. For example, if you wager £500 and win £300, your net loss is £200. If the casino offers a 10% cashback, you would receive £20 back. Understanding this calculation is crucial for evaluating the value of cashback offers.
What Are Common Wagering Requirements?
Cashback offers often come with wagering requirements. These can vary significantly between casinos. A common requirement might be 35x the cashback amount before you can withdraw your funds. If you received £20 cashback, you would need to wager £700 before cashing out. Always read the terms thoroughly to understand these requirements.

What Are the Limitations of Cashback Offers?
While cashback offers can be great, they are not without limitations:
- Wagering Requirements: High requirements can make it hard to benefit.
- Exclusions: Some games may not contribute towards the wagering requirements.
- Time Limits: Cashback offers are often time-sensitive and require you to act quickly.
